Helen Wright is a scholar working on Plant Science, Pharmacology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Helen Wright has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Plant Science, 9 papers in Pharmacology and 5 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. Recurrent topics in Helen Wright's work include Plant Disease Resistance and Genetics (10 papers),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(9 papers) and Innovations in Medical Education (4 papers). Helen Wright is often cited by papers focused on Plant Disease Resistance and Genetics (10 papers),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(9 papers) and Innovations in Medical Education (4 papers). Helen Wright collaborates with scholars based in Australia, United Kingdom and United States. Helen Wright's co-authors include David A. Hopwood, Tobias Kieser, Maureen J. Bibb, Charles J. Thompson, Derek J. Lydiate, Francisco Malpartida, D. A. Hopwood, Gilberto Hintermann, E.J.A. Lea and Jeremy H. Lakey and has published in prestigious journals such as PEDIATRICS, International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health and Microbiology.
